The police are investigating an early morning fire which damaged the unoccupied Army Base of the Second Infantry Battalion at Maria’s Lodge, Essequibo Coast.

Stabroek News was informed that the fire started between 3 am and 3.30 am this morning. Quick action by alert residents prevented the fire from spreading.

The floor of the building was  partially burnt along the southern and northern walls.

Reports are that neighbours observed fire coming from the top flat of the building.

An alarm was raised and public-spirited citizens managed to contain the blaze by forming a bucket of brigade.

The Guyana Fire Service was summoned.

The building had no electricity connection.
